Guest: Claire Berryman, Assistant Professor of Nutrition, Food and Exercise Sciences at Florida State University You’ve probably had your cholesterol tested in the last year or so got the report about good and bad cholesterol in your blood? Some new nutritional research finds that eating almonds as a snack can help boost good cholesterol levels and get rid of the bad. A two-for-one!
